The first part of the thesis describes a transformation which can be used to relate the strong coupling limit of the (theta 4)3 quantum field theory to the weak coupling limit of the same theory. This transformation can be used to show the existence of a phase transition in the above theory as the coupling constant is increased with the mass parameter held fixed. The derivation of the transformation involves Zimmerman normal operator techniques. The second part of the thesis describes a variational calculation of the classical interactions of 't Hooft monopoles. These interactions are interesting because 't Hooft monopoles appear as instantons in the Georgi-Glashow theory of weak and electromagnetic interactions. The interactions of the instantons are directly related to the question of confinement of the fermions in this theory.","abstract_html":"This thesis contains the descriptions of two new non-perturbative results in relativistic field theory.
